Today we’d like to introduce you to Bosede Iyewarun.

Hi Bosede, can you start by introducing yourself? We’d love to learn more about how you got to where you are today?
I started as a self-taught jewelry designer in 2011 and created a jewelry brand called Earkandie! It became a sensation and each year for my anniversary which was in November; I came up with a new collection and would opt to showcase each new collection on the runway as I did not have an actual storefront. Every year I would select a non-for-profit organization to donate a portion of the proceeds to and the show would sell out every year. After five years of having the Earkandie! Fashion Show Extravaganza; God gave me a bigger vision allowing me to showcase more designers, offer more models an opportunity and give back more! So the 6th year; I began to work on rebranding Earkandie! Fashion Show Extravaganza into Heartland International Fashion Week! So in 2017, HIFW was founded and created. We all face challenges, but looking back would you describe it as a relatively smooth road?
It was a lot of ups and downs as with any huge task and brand. I went through a period of losing team members and really having to stay faithful and believing God would bring the right people to help me bring the vision to life. I knew I had to surround myself with not only believers of faith but also individuals who knew what it was to run a brand and be committed to finishing what they start. Sponsors and Partners were also a bit difficult to find due to the fact that this was new and nobody had heard of HIFW. After establishing a strong following on Instagram, Facebook, Google Plus and traffic on the website; it came easier to have conversations with Boutiques and local organizations to get them on board. We were fortunate to acquire partnerships with Dillard’s Oak Park Mall, Oak Park Beauty, The Negro League Baseball Museum, The Lee’s Summit Airport, The Gown Gallery Kansas City, Giselle’s Bridal KC and Bellus Academy Manhattan to name a few for Season 1.

Bosede A Iyewarun is the Founder and Visionary of Heartland International Fashion WeekTM, CEO of Lady Bosses International, Director and Founder of Branding Masterclass By HIFW.

Leveraging her business skills and her love for Sales, Marketing and Fashion; she founded her Jewelry line EarKandie! in 2010. In 2012 she founded Lady Bosses International which is a nonprofit organization in an effort to Uplift, Empower, and Encourage Lady Bosses from all around the globe through Professional Etiquette courses and Business/Personal Branding. The EarKandie! Model Academy and Management Company was founded June 2015 and later transformed into Branding Masterclass By HIFW in 2020. Her passion lies in investing in the youth and young adults with emphasis on instilling Self-Esteem and Confidence Building both in the Modeling Industry and for Personal Life Skills. Her desire to also create a platform for not only American models but models, designers and entrepreneurs from every part of the world drove her to establish Heartland International Fashion Week, Known for her role in the fashion industry in Kansas City Missouri, her desire to train and Mentor models of all shapes and sizes, and her affiliation with Fashion Group International, Ms. Iyewarun has created a brand as well as a following which enables her to create a platform that is well received within the fashion industry.
